Output 70179e63b8f20ab3db00e86b1a84bd8246d85e63a0f96c8df52535243e09dbde:0

value
665868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b5f908ff1846422383aa2aaf5edea20949a2eb0 OP_EQUALVERIFY OP_CHECKSIG
address
14xLYCcYNfwWf8nPhvuJafYUvjXDEPRS7s
transaction
70179e63b8f20ab3db00e86b1a84bd8246d85e63a0f96c8df52535243e09dbde
spent
true